The chart below helps you understand the logic behind those results.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>Quick Answer:<\/strong> An Affenpinscher\u2019s age does not follow a simple 1:7 rule. In general, a 1-year-old Affenpinscher is about 15 human years, a 2-year-old is about 24, and after that each year equals roughly 4\u20135 human years. Small breeds like Affenpinschers age quickly early on, then slow down in adulthood.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">This is why comparing dog years directly to human years can be confusing for owners. For an Affenpinscher, it often produces misleading results.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Why Small Dogs Like Affenpinschers Age Differently<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Large dogs tend to age faster and have shorter lifespans, while small breeds like Affenpinschers generally live longer and stay active into later years.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">How Affenpinscher Aging Compares to Other Small Dogs<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Affenpinschers follow a similar aging pattern to many other small dog breeds. They mature quickly in the first 1 to 2 years, then move through adulthood more slowly than medium or large dogs. This is one reason small breeds often have longer lifespans and later senior years.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Even within small breeds, however, lifespan and health patterns can vary. Factors such as genetics, weight, activity, and routine care all influence how a dog ages over time.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Affenpinscher Age Chart (Dog Years to Human Years)<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">This section helps explain <strong>how an Affenpinscher\u2019s age compares to human years<\/strong>. For a broader look at the breed\u2019s personality, care needs, and traits, see our <a href=\"https:\/\/petageinhumanyearscalculator.com\/blog\/affenpinscher-dog-breed-guide\/\">Affenpinscher Dog Breed Guide<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Below is a simple overview of the main life stages for an Affenpinscher.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-table\"><table class=\"has-fixed-layout\"><thead><tr><th>Age Range<\/th><th>Life Stage<\/th><th>What to Expect<\/th><\/tr><\/thead><tbody><tr><td>0\u20131 year<\/td><td>Puppy<\/td><td>Fast growth, learning, high energy, needs training and social time<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>1\u20138 years<\/td><td>Adult<\/td><td>Best health years, playful but calmer, steady routine<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>9+ years<\/td><td>Senior<\/td><td>Slower movement, more rest, needs extra care and checkups<\/td><\/tr><\/tbody><\/table><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">When Does an Affenpinscher Become a Senior?<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Most Affenpinschers are considered seniors at around 9 years old. This does not mean they suddenly become unhealthy or inactive. It simply means they are entering a later life stage where joint care, dental care, and more frequent health checks become more important.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">During the puppy stage, Affenpinschers grow very quickly. They learn how to walk, play, listen, and explore the world. This is the best time for training, socializing, and building good habits. For more on this stage, visit our <a href=\"https:\/\/petageinhumanyearscalculator.com\/blog\/affenpinscher-training-guide\/\">Affenpinscher Training Guide<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The senior stage often begins around 9 years old. At this point, many Affenpinschers may start showing slower movement, longer sleep periods, or mild changes in vision, hearing, or memory. Even so, many remain playful and alert, especially with regular care and gentle daily activity.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Common Signs of Aging in Affenpinschers<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">As Affenpinschers get older, owners may begin to notice gradual physical or behavioral changes such as: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Less energy than before<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Stiff joints or slower movement<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Weight changes<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>More sleeping<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Changes in hearing or eyesight<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">What Affects How Fast an Affenpinscher Ages?<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Not every Affenpinscher ages at exactly the same speed.
